KCR must quit as CM if he is helpless in bailing out paddy farmers: Revanth

Hyderabad/New Delhi, Nov.30 (Maxim News): Telangana Pradesh Congress Committee (TPCC) President & MP A. Revanth Reddy has accused Chief Minister K. Chandrashekhar Rao (KCR) of putting the lives and livelihood of lakhs of Telangana farmers at stake by refusing to purchase crops in the Yasangi season.

Addressing a press conference in New Delhi on Tuesday, Revanth Reddy slammed KCR for leaving the farmers in a state of confusion. “KCR is asking the farmers not to cultivate paddy. But he is neither suggesting an alternate crop nor giving an assurance of buying it at MSP. He even announced that there won’t be any procurement centres in the next season. He simply disowned all the farmers and left them to their fate,” he said.

The TPCC Chief asked CM KCR to explain whether or not an agriculture policy exists in Telangana. “TRS Govt is claiming that it had spent nearly Rs. 3 lakh crore to create irrigation facilities for 1 crore acres of land. KCR also claims that his government is providing water for every acre of land, free power and investment support through the Rythu Bandhu scheme. What is the use of all these things if the government is not willing to purchase the agricultural produce? Union Minister G. Kishan Reddy made an open statement in a press conference announcing that the Centre would not buy the crops in the Yasangi season. Now KCR too has disowned the farmers by saying that the State Govt will not buy crops from next season. What should the farmers do now?” he asked.

“When a Chief Minister is expressing helplessness in bailing out the farmers, then he has no right to remain on the post given to him by the people. KCR has no right to continue as CM and people will never forgive him for his mistakes which ruined the lives of lakhs of farmers,” he said.

Revanth Reddy alleged that CM KCR was fully aware of conditions laid down by the Centre on the purchase of paddy in Kharif season by the Food Corporation of India in the month of August. However, KCR did not react till the end of harvesting while delaying all other processes involved in the purchase of paddy. The BJP and TRS Govt started the blame game when the harvested paddy reached the farm yarns and procurement centres for sale. “By refusing to purchase the produce, BJP and TRS Govts are making it inevitable for farmers to turn to corporate powers. Now the farmers will be forced to sell their crops to Adani and Ambani at whatever price they offer,” he said.

The TPCC Chief said it was highly unfortunate that Telangana, which is known as the Rice Bowl of Bowl, will not cultivate the paddy. He said KCR could not escape from his responsibility as the Chief Minister by asking farmers not to grow paddy. “If the Centre is refusing to purchase the crop, then the State Government must intervene by buying the produce to help the farmers,” he said.

He said that the government must provide all facilities and assure MSP if it was asking them to grow alternate crops. He said that the Congress Government in Chhattisgarh not only ensured MSP to the farmers, but also provided a bonus when it suggested alternate crops.

Revanth Reddy alleged that KCR Government played similar stunts in the past by advising farmers against growing maize, sugarcane and cotton. Now he is directing them not to cultivate rice. He said sugarcane farmers in Nizamabad and chilli farmers of Warangal and Khammam were humiliated when they asked for MSP. He said Girijan farmers in Khammam were implicated in false cases, arrested and chained when they asked for proper remuneration for their produce.

Revanth dares KCR to stage ‘fast-unto-death’ in Delhi on farmers’ issue

The TPCC President challenged KCR to stage a ‘fast-unto-death’ at Jantar Mantar in Delhi if he was really serious about paddy farmers. Calling KCR’s call for battle against Modi Govt on farmers issue as fake and hollow, he said KCR must leave Hyderabad and begin his protest in the national capital. “Unlike Congress, KCR can never fight with the BJP head-on. He is afraid that the Modi Govt will begin investigation into his corrupt activities if he transforms himself into a rival instead of remaining a secret ally,” he said.

“When opposition parties, including the Congress, wanted a debate on the farmers’ issue during the repeal of three controversial farm laws, TRS MPs sabotaged the efforts. The entire opposition wanted a discussion on the law for Minimum Support Price, cases registered against farmers and compensation for the families of those who died during the agitation. But the TRS MPs came to the rescue of Prime Minister Narendra Modi and BJP Govt by stalling the proceedings so as to facilitate the passing of repeal of farm laws without debate,” he alleged.

Revanth said that the Congress and other opposition parties would’ve forced BJP Govt to apologise for the death of over 750 farmers during the agitation and pay compensation to their families. Further, the opposition would’ve forced the Modi Govt to announce withdrawal of all cases registered against farmers during the agitation. But TRS MPs, as part of their joint strategy with the BJP, stalled the House facilitating the passing of repeal of farm bills.

He said if the TRS was sincere, then why did it not issue a Whip asking all its MPs to be present in the House on Monday. He pointed out that three out of nine TRS MPs – Kotha Prabhakar Reddy, Maloth Kavitha and P. Dayakar – were absent when the BJP Govt introduced the Bill to repeal the farm laws. The remaining MPs took a picture in the House to mislead the people as if they were genuinely fighting for the farmers.

The TPCC Chief alleged that KCR family has acquired more wealth than the last Nizam of Hyderabad. Therefore, KCR will never dare to question the anti-farmer policies of Modi Govt. “Modi Government was forced to repeal the black laws. But KCR is implementing all the provisions of repealed laws in Telangana State,” he alleged.

Revanth Reddy announced that the Congress party would not allow TRS-BJP Governments to exploit the farmers. “We will intensify our battle and will not rest until the Centre and State Governments purchase every grain produced by Telangana farmers,” he announced. (Maxim News)
